Product introduction
Levora LB 500mg Tablet should be used in the dose and duration as advised by your doctor. It may be taken with or without food, preferably at a fixed time. Avoid skipping any doses and finish the full course of treatment even if you feel better. Do not take a double dose to make up for a missed dose. Simply take the next dose as planned.
You may have a headache, dizziness, nausea, and bloating as side effects of this medicine. These are usually temporary and resolves on its own, but please consult your doctor if it bothers you or persists for a longer duration.
Special care should be taken in people with kidney problems while taking this medicine. This medicine is not normally recommended during pregnancy or while breastfeeding unless it is clearly needed. You should also let your healthcare team know all other medicines you are taking as they may affect, or be affected by this medicine.

Benefits of Levora LB Tablet
Levora LB 500mg Tablet is an antibiotic medicine prescribed to treat various infections caused by bacteria. These include diarrhea, sinus infections (sinusitis), chest infections such as bronchitis and pneumonia, skin infections, prostate infections (prostatitis), and urinary tract infections. Levora LB 500mg Tablet also contains Lactobacillus that restores the level of good bacteria in your stomach and thus prevents stomach upset due to the antibiotic.

Quick tips
- Levora LB 500mg Tablet should be taken with or without food but at the same time every day.
- Do not skip any doses and finish the full course of treatment even if you feel better.
- Discontinue Levora LB 500mg Tablet and inform your doctor immediately if you get a rash, itchy skin, swelling of face and mouth, or have difficulty in breathing.
- Diarrhea may occur as a side effect but should stop when your course is complete. Inform your doctor if it doesn't stop or if you find blood in your stools.
- It is advisable to stay hydrated and drink plenty of water to overcome medicine side effects.
